Exemplo n.º 1
0
        public DockWidgetScript()
            : base()
        {
            mParent          = null;
            mBackgroundColor = new Color(1f, 1f, 1f, 1f);
            mImage           = Assets.DockWidgets.Textures.icon;
            mTokenId         = R.sections.DockWidgets.strings.Count;

            mContentTransform       = null;
            mContentBackgroundImage = null;
        }
        public DockWidgetScript()
            : base()
        {
            DebugEx.Verbose("Created DockWidgetScript object");

            mParent          = null;
            mBackgroundColor = Assets.Common.DockWidgets.Colors.background;
            mImage           = Assets.Common.DockWidgets.Textures.icon.sprite;
            mTokenId         = R.sections.DockWidgets.strings.Count;

            mContentTransform       = null;
            mContentBackgroundImage = null;
        }
Exemplo n.º 3
0
        public DockWidgetScript()
            : base()
        {
            DebugEx.Verbose("Created DockWidgetScript object");

            mParent          = null;
            mBackgroundColor = Assets.Common.DockWidgets.Colors.background;
            mImage           = Assets.Common.DockWidgets.Textures.icon.sprite;
            mTokenId         = R.sections.DockWidgets.strings.Count;

            mContentTransform       = null;
            mContentBackgroundImage = null;
        }
Exemplo n.º 4
0
        /// <summary>
        /// Return the string value associated with a particular resource ID.
        /// </summary>
        /// <returns>Localized string.</returns>
        /// <param name="id">String resource ID.</param>
        public static string GetString(R.sections.DockWidgets.strings id)
        {
            UnityTranslationInternal.Translator.LoadSection(R.sections.SectionID.DockWidgets, false);

            if (
                UnityTranslationInternal.Translator.tokens[(int)R.sections.SectionID.DockWidgets + 1].selectedLanguage != null
                &&
                UnityTranslationInternal.Translator.tokens[(int)R.sections.SectionID.DockWidgets + 1].selectedLanguage.stringValues[(int)id] != null
                )
            {
                return(UnityTranslationInternal.Translator.tokens[(int)R.sections.SectionID.DockWidgets + 1].selectedLanguage.stringValues[(int)id]);
            }
            else
            {
                return(UnityTranslationInternal.Translator.tokens[(int)R.sections.SectionID.DockWidgets + 1].defaultLanguage.stringValues[(int)id]);
            }
        }
Exemplo n.º 5
0
 /// <summary>
 /// Return the string value associated with a particular resource ID, substituting the format arguments as defined in string.Format.
 /// </summary>
 /// <returns>Localized string.</returns>
 /// <param name="id">String resource ID.</param>
 /// <param name="formatArgs">Format arguments.</param>
 public static string GetString(R.sections.DockWidgets.strings id, params object[] formatArgs)
 {
     return(string.Format(GetString(id), formatArgs));
 }